Diagnosis

If you are referred to psychiatrists for an ADHD assessment they will ask questions regarding your current issues and the causes. Then, they will determine whether you meet the ADHD criteria by assessing your hyperactivity as well as inattention symptoms. They will also ask you about your childhood experiences. They will also explain why they don't believe you are in compliance with the ADHD criteria. It could be because they do not recognize the evidence behind your problems or because they believe that a different disorder is more responsible for your symptoms. You can always request a private assessment should you disagree with their decision.

You might wish to record some examples of the characteristics or symptoms that you believe you are suffering from, so that you will be able to remember. Your doctor will evaluate these against the DSM V criteria for ADHD. It is crucial to be truthful with your clinician, as they are able to only assess you based on the information you give them.

If you receive a diagnosis of ADHD Your doctor will discuss the treatment options with you. You may choose to opt for psychotherapy or medication instead of medication. The psychiatrist will be able to advise you on the best approach for your particular situation.

The psychiatrist can provide you with written reports that can be used to justify your claim for benefits. If you are an undergraduate student, you can use the report to apply for Disabled Students allowance. This will grant you money to purchase equipment, software and support workers and coaches to assist you with your studies. You can also make use of your report to claim Personal Independence Payments.

Medication

If you're diagnosed with ADHD as an adult, medication is often suggested. The medication can help reduce symptoms, which makes it easier to live your life. Medication can be taken on its own or with psychotherapy, which is also advised.

If your GP suspects that you may have ADHD they should take this seriously and refer you to an expert to conduct an assessment. The assessment will be conducted by a psychiatrist or psychologist as they are the only healthcare professionals in the UK who are able to diagnose ADHD. During the assessment you will be asked about your symptoms and your family history. The healthcare professional will examine your symptoms and compare them to the criteria for ADHD in adults.

The NHS has a waiting list of up to three months, which is the reason some people opt to pay for a private ADHD assessment. It is important to keep in mind that the BBC investigation revealed that some private practitioners offer inaccurate diagnoses. This could cause problems for those who need treatment. It's best to research the provider thoroughly prior to booking.

In your private ADHD assessment, the health care professional will ask you about any issues or issues you face for example, difficulties in school or at work. You will be asked to describe your general health. The healthcare professional will assess your symptoms and look for any other conditions, such as Depression or anxiety.

After the private adhd assessment cost ADHD assessment is completed you will be given a thorough report along with an assessment. The report will include a comprehensive treatment plan and medications options (if required) and other information that you can share with your GP. In the majority of cases, a shared-care agreement can be arranged with your GP to pay only the NHS prescription fee for medications.
